Most aircon businesses chase ducted and treat splits as scraps, then wonder why the pipeline swings. We run both. Splits give you the consistent weekly work that keeps the vans full; ducted enquiries land on top.
Here's the part your competitors haven't worked out: none of it dies in winter. Reverse cycle is heating, and heating searches spike from May. The homeowner freezing through July isn't searching "air conditioning," but they're absolutely searching "ducted heating and cooling" or "reverse cycle installation," and most aircon businesses have gone quiet by then. That's the gap we put you in: the money searches, year round, while everyone else hibernates.
Speed-to-lead still matters. A $12k ducted enquiry gets three quotes, and a split install customer books whoever answers first. Every enquiry hits your phone by SMS the moment it comes in.
Run your own numbers. A standard back-to-back split install is $600 to $1,500 in labour, plus your markup on sundries and your margin on the unit if you're supplying it. Call it a four-figure job that takes two blokes half a day. A ducted install is $8,000 to $15,000.
